ASSUMPTIONS · DEFAULTS
  • Pool ARPU benchmarks: wallet €8/yr · card €24/yr · cross-border €18/yr · investments €60/yr.
  • Wave-1 captures ~10% of the fintech-user TAM (wallet pool only) in the first 90 days.
  • Wave-2 captures ~55% at half intensity over months 4–12.
  • A user can be in multiple pools. Pool revenues are additive.
  • Currency rounded; 1 working day ≈ 24h. No FX, no tax, no churn applied here.

·Caveats

What this calculator is — and is not.

It is an indicative model for a partner-led Wave-1/Wave-2 telco × bank deployment in an EU-equivalent regulatory environment, with ARPU benchmarks taken from production Coreal-powered programs and from public BaaS data.

It is not a sales projection, a financial forecast, or a fairness opinion. Real outcomes depend on regulatory posture, sponsor-bank terms, telco data-sharing scope, FX, churn and operational discipline. Treat the numbers as order of magnitude, not a target.
